Output 0d4d8a1d75537fa5ed6dee661ba90a0cb564be122002e6ea2a63a9ee13decdea:18

value
11392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d59eab8ea91d6254705a8da014eb9d29f3d627 OP_EQUAL
address
3KYVbWpb1oFsoz7ArdBhDCbDM3n9pRXx6V
transaction
0d4d8a1d75537fa5ed6dee661ba90a0cb564be122002e6ea2a63a9ee13decdea
confirmations
14096
spent
true